This market will resolve to “Yes” if Mykhailo Fedorov is reinstated as Ukraine’s Minister of Defense by the listed date at 11:59 PM Kyiv time. Otherwise, this market will resolve to “No.” Fedorov will be considered reinstated if he is either i) officially assigned to temporarily perform the minister’s duties or ii) formally nominated for appointment by President Volodymyr Zelenskyy to the Verkhovna Rada. A temporary reinstatement will be considered to have occurred when the President of Ukraine or the Cabinet of Ministers of Ukraine officially and definitively announces that Mykhailo Fedorov has been assigned to temporarily perform the duties of the Minister of Defense. A formal nomination will be considered to have occurred upon the submission of Mykhailo Fedorov’s nomination to the Verkhovna Rada. A public statement, media report, expression of intent, or informal announcement will not qualify, unless it constitutes an official and definitive announcement by the President of Ukraine or the Cabinet of Ministers assigning Fedorov to perform the minister’s duties. Fedorov does not need to be approved by the Verkhovna Rada, take the oath of office, or assume the position on a permanent basis to qualify. Whether any individual other than Mykhailo Fedorov is nominated, temporarily assigned, or appointed Minister of Defense, within the market timeframe, will not be considered. The primary resolution sources for this market will be official information and records from the President of Ukraine, the Cabinet of Ministers of Ukraine, and the Verkhovna Rada; however, a consensus of credible reporting may also be used.President Volodymyr Zelenskyy dismissed Mykhailo Fedorov as Ukraine’s defense minister on July 15, 2026, after six months in the role, as part of a broader cabinet reshuffle that included the prime minister’s resignation and parliamentary approval of a new government. Fedorov, previously minister of digital transformation, had prioritized drone production, data-driven reforms, and anti-corruption measures during his tenure. His removal triggered protests in multiple cities, with demonstrators calling for his reinstatement amid reported tensions with Armed Forces Commander-in-Chief Oleksandr Syrskyi over military modernization and conscription policy. Fedorov publicly stated he had urged Syrskyi’s replacement—a request Zelenskyy declined—and left open the possibility of returning to the post, though the new cabinet structure and legislative confirmation process create clear procedural barriers. Any reversal would require Zelenskyy to renominate him and secure Verkhovna Rada support before the current transition stabilizes.
